1949 Allard P1 vs. 1956 Chevrolet Bel Air

To start off, 1956 Chevrolet Bel Air is newer by 7 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1949 Allard P1.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1949 Allard P1 would be higher. At 4,343 cc (8 cylinders), 1956 Chevrolet Bel Air is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1956 Chevrolet Bel Air (148 HP) has 63 more horse power than 1949 Allard P1. (85 HP) In normal driving conditions, 1956 Chevrolet Bel Air should accelerate faster than 1949 Allard P1.
